Zeta Cameron ★★☆☆☆
I went here with my boyfriend for our Valentine's meal. The service was the best thing about our experience. The staff were caring and attentive. The food was good. Not excellent, but good. My main issue is that when I booked over the phone, they didn't mention the fact that there would be a set menu, which cost £150. With drinks, it was a £200 bill. I'm no stranger to fine dining, and knew it wouldn't be cheap, but I think the customer should be made aware of this before they're at the table and the food starts arriving. Other diners said similar. We won't be going back.
